Atsomepointweallwillberequiredtowearatie,buthowdoyoutieatie?
Toanswerthatquestion,I'vedrawnupastep-by-stepinstructiontoaneasytieknot(结)tohelpyou.
Four-in-Handknotistheeasiesttolearn.Itisasmalltieknotthatsuitsshirtswitha
narrowcollar(领子)openingandissuitableformostsituations,butitdoesn'tlooklikegood
onwidecollarshirts.Sinceitdoesn'tlooklikeyouneedtospendtoomuchtimeinfrontofthemirrorseriouslytyingit.Youcanjustquicklyputonatieandgooutthedoor.Also,ifyou'reeverinahurry,thisisthe-knottoknow.
•1.Beginbycrossingthewideendoverthenarrowend.
•2.Foldthewideendunderthenarrowend.
•3.Passthewideendoverthenarrowendagain.
•4.Takethewideendupandthroughthecirclearoundyourneck.
•5.Takethewideendthroughtheknotinfront.Tighten(变紧)theknotandpullituptoyour
collar.
It'simportantformentolearnthisbasicknotthemselves.Justusethiseasystep-by-step
instructionontyingatieandpracticeit.It'sreallynotthathard.Youjustneedtopracticeitalot.
